Many SCCs of the head and neck are treated surgically with primary resection and possibly neck dissection. Some patients can present with metastatic SCC in the neck, but despite careful clinical and radiologic workup, a primary tumor cannot be found. In these cases, TIPV analysis, particularly using an in situ hybridization approach, can be useful. In several series, HPV-associated tumors are largely restricted to the tonsil and tongue base area. When HPV is positive in the neck nodes from a patient with an unknown primary tumor, the clinical management can be directed toward these high-risk areas. [Pg.261]

The analysis should use a logical approach which models how the event sequences progress from core damage to a radiological release. This is usually done by event tree analysis which models the accident sequence in a number of time frames and uses a set of nodal questions to model the sequence of events which occur. The construction of the event trees needs to be supported by thermal-hydraulic calculations and modelling of fission product release and transport inside the containment. [Pg.64]
